What is a manager solution architect?

Manager Solution Architects are professionals who lead teams responsible for designing and implementing technology solutions that meet business needs. They bridge the gap between business requirements and technical implementation by overseeing solution architecture, ensuring alignment with organizational goals, and managing architectural standards. Additionally, they coordinate with stakeholders, guide architecture best practices, and mentor solution architects and technical teams. Their role is crucial in delivering scalable, secure, and effective IT systems.

How does a manager solution architect typically collaborate with cross-functional teams during a project lifecycle?

A Manager Solution Architecture plays a key role in bridging technical and business teams throughout a project's lifecycle. They work closely with stakeholders, such as business analysts, developers, project managers, and executives, to ensure that solution designs align with both technical requirements and business goals. This often involves facilitating workshops, reviewing architecture documentation, and guiding technical teams through implementation challenges. Regular communication and feedback loops are essential to ensure alignment, address roadblocks early, and deliver solutions that meet organizational needs.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a manager solution architect,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Manager Solution Architecture, you need deep expertise in system design, enterprise architecture frameworks, and leadership, typically supported by a degree in computer science and experience in solution architecture roles. Familiarity with cloud platforms (such as AWS or Azure), architecture modeling tools (like TOGAF or ArchiMate), and relevant certifications (e.g., AWS Certified Solutions Architect) is essential. Strong communication, strategic thinking, and stakeholder management skills help you effectively lead teams and align technical solutions with business objectives. These capabilities ensure the delivery of scalable, secure, and cost-effective architectures that support organizational goals.

What is the difference between Manager Solution Architecture vs Solution Architect?

AspectManager Solution ArchitectureSolution Architect
CredentialsTypically requires a bachelor’s degree in computer science or related field; certifications like TOGAF or AWS Certified Solutions Architect are commonSame as Manager Solution Architecture, often holds certifications like TOGAF, AWS, or Azure
Work EnvironmentLeads teams, manages projects, and collaborates with stakeholders in enterprise settingsDesigns technical solutions, works closely with development teams and clients
Employer & Industry UsageUsed in large enterprises, consulting firms, and tech companiesCommon across industries requiring technical solution design and implementation

The main difference is that a Manager Solution Architecture oversees teams and manages solution delivery, while a Solution Architect focuses on designing technical solutions. Both roles require similar credentials and work in comparable environments, but their responsibilities differ in scope and focus.

KBX Logistics is looking for a Lead Solution Architect (Data & AI) to lead solution architecture for our Enterprise Data Platform (EDP) and help evolve it into an AI-enabled data platform. This is a hands‑on role for someone who brings deep AWS solution architecture expertise and can evaluate, design, and implement AI capabilities that improve how users interact with enterprise data.

You’ll bring deep AWS solution architecture expertise and a builder’s mindset, with the ability to evaluate, architect, and deliver emerging AI capabilities over enterprise data. Prior hands‑on AI implementation experience is valuable, but we recognize that AI technologies continue to evolve rapidly and are looking for someone who can help shape KBX’s long‑term AI architecture strategy while growing with the space.

Our Team

TheKBXDataOpsteam builds and supports enterprise data capabilitieshoused in AWSthat help business teams access trusted data, improve decision-making, and scale analytics. We partner across business, technology, governance, cloud, and security teams to deliver reliable data products and modern platform capabilities.

What You Will Do
  • Design and evolve the architecture of the Enterprise Data Platform, including the integration patterns, governance controls, and platform capabilities required to support analytics, automation, AI, and agent‑based use cases.
  • Lead solution architecture and hands‑on delivery of scalable data platform capabilities, including self‑service access patterns, APIs, data products, metadata services, and AI‑enabled experiences.
  • Translate business, data, and AI opportunities into production‑ready architecture patterns that balance scalability, security, maintainability, and speed to value.
  • Build foundational platform capabilities including metadata management, semantic models, orchestration frameworks, secure access patterns, observability, and governance services that enable analytics, automation, and AI workloads.
  • Serve as the hands‑on architectural lead for the team's AWS‑native platform architecture,owning design decisions anddirectlycontributing to implementation
  • Continuously modernize data pipelines to reduce redundancy, control cost, and improve reliability and observability.
  • Codify reusable architecture patterns (Terraform) and mentordataengineersto scale successful patterns across initiatives/projects.
  • Serveasthesolution architecture contributor in architecture review processes
Who You Are (Basic Qualifications)
  • Experience evaluating, designing, maintaining, or implementing AI/GenAI capabilities within enterprise data and technology environments.
  • Experience designing solutions using AWS technologies such as Glue, S3, Redshift, Lambda, Step Functions, and IAMroles andpolicies.
  • Exposure to applying GenAI/LLM patterns over enterprise data
  • Experience applying the following fundamentals as a solution architect: RBAC, data lineage, DR/HA, modular design, cost optimization.
  • Experience influencing architecture and architectural strategy across the organization at various levels
What Will Put You Ahead
  • Experience implementing Model Context Protocol (MCP) or comparable AI-to-data integration patterns.
  • Experience building enterprise AI solutions using LLMs, copilots, agents, or retrieval‑based architectures.
  • Experience designing AI infrastructure on AWS or other cloud platforms.
  • Experience developing AI governance, security, and operating patterns.
  • Experience building semantic, metadata, or orchestration layers that enable AI‑based data access.
  • Experience evaluating emerging AI technologies and translating them into scalable enterprise architecture patterns.
  • Experience designing layered data architectures across cloud platforms, including immutable raw‑data retention, standardized transformation layers, and curated analytics or semantic‑serving layers.
  • Experience partnering with IT Security teams on IAM and secure data access pattern initiatives
  • Experience mentoringdataengineers andestablishingreusablearchitecturestandards/patterns that scale across teams
